1、要实现数字和字母的对应关系,可以使用Python中的字典数据结构。可以创建一个字典,将数字作为键,字母作为值。例如,可以使用以下代码创建一个数字和字母的对应关系:
2、print("str1小于str2")
3、print("str1等于str2")
4、第一种是使用ASCII码表,将每个字母对应的ASCII码值与数字的ASCII码值进行对比,从而得出对应关系。
5、else:
6、在这个示例中,根据字母的ASCII值进行比较,"le"的ASCII值小于"banana",因此str1小于str2。
7、python中,中英文比较大小的话实质是比较的它的ascii码,
8、在Python中,可以使用内置的字符串比较运算符进行英文大小比较。Python默认使用基于字符的ASCII值进行比较,因此可以使用<、>、<=、>=、==等比较运算符进行字符串的大小比较。
9、ifstr1 10、pythonCopycode 11、int在python里是一个类,它是不可变数据类型中的一种,它的一些性质和字符串是一样的,是整型。 12、print("科学计数法:%e"%num) 13、str1小于str2 14、elifstr1>str2: 15、第二种方法是使用字典,将每个字母作为键,对应的数字作为值,以此建立字母与数字的映射关系。 16、在python中,复数的表示是【实数部+虚数部】,而虚数在pytho中是使用后缀大写字母J表示的。因此复数3+4i在python中表示为3+4J:ff=3+4Jprint(ff.real)#实数部print(ff.imag)#虚数部在python中复数可以直接进行加减乘除运算,你可以使用变量来进行也可以使用括号来进行:f1=3+4Jf2=7-8Jprint(f1*f2)print((3+4J)*(7-8J)) 17、str1="le" 18、例如,可以创建一个包含26个字母与对应数字的字典,通过查询字典实现字母与数字的对应。这两种方法都能有效地实现数字字母的对应,具体选用哪种方法取决于具体应用场景和需要。 19、例如,字母A的ASCII码值为65,数字1的ASCII码值为49,两者相差16,因此可以将字母A与数字1对应起来。 20、以下是一些示例: 21、使用不同的编码方式,得到的结果占用位数也不相同。 22、print("str1大于str2") 23、str2="banana" 24、letter=ming[2] 25、需要注意的是,Python的字符串比较是基于字符的ASCII值进行的,对于非ASCII字符或多字节字符,可能需要使用其他方法进行比较,如使用Unicode编码或特定的字符串比较函数。 26、然后,可以通过访问字典中的键来获取对应的值。例如,要获取数字2对应的字母,可以使用以下代码: 27、输出结果: 28、其中,“%e”表示输出的格式为科学计数法。在输出时,Python将数字转换为指数形式,并使用字母“e”表示指数。因此,上面的代码将数字1234567890转换为1.234568e+09的形式。这样,就可以将输入转换为科学计数法,方便进行科学计算和数据处理。 29、在Python中,可以使用两种方法实现数字字母的对应关系。 30、这将返回字母'B'。通过这种方式,可以实现数字和字母之间的对应关系,并根据需要进行访问和操作。 31、Python可以使用科学计数法格式化方法,将输入转换为科学计数法。科学计数法格式化方法是使用字符串格式化操作符“%”和“e”选项来实现的。例如,要将数字1234567890转换为科学计数法,可以使用以下代码: 32、例如Aa比大小,a>A,小写a的码值比大写的大 33、用字典刚刚好,字母做键,数字做值,反过来也可以。 34、科学计数可以直接写,比如a=1.3e-4如果你要把一个数字使用科学计数法打印出来,使用响应的格式化字符串即可,比如print('{:e}'.format(a)) 35、python2的len()能够得到一个字符串里有多少个字符。而一个字符占多少位,那就不好说了。比如说unicode字符是固定占两个字节(16位)。而utf8编码是变长码,英文字符占一个字节(8位),汉字占二到四个字节(16到32位)。 36、所以说想知道一个字符串占多少位,需要先把它从自然语义,编码成计算机能认识的编码。 37、num=1234567890 38、ming={1:'A',2:'B',3:'C',4:'D',5:'E'} 39、输出结果为:1.234568e+09 40、Copycode 41、Python中的标识符是用于识别变量、函数、类、模块以及其他对象的名字,标识符可以包含字母、数字及下划线(_),但是必须以一个非数字字符开始。字母仅仅包括ISO-Latin字符集中的A–Z和a–z。标识符对大小写敏感的,因此FOO和foo是两个不同的对象。